I am planning to build up a Dolan TC1 frameset for use on the track. My crankset of choice is a Stronglight track 2000 with the recommended 107 mm bottom bracket for a 42mm chainline. I know that Dolan have had problems with other models, noticeably the Pre Cursa with cranks hitting the chain stay for this length of BB. Has this problem been solved? Has anyone any advice on the TC1 please?

    Not aware of any chainline issues with the TC1. There were issues with some earlier versions of the Precursa as you say, but that was a few years ago now.

    You don't say which Sugino chainset Dolan has recommended. Did they recommend it because, generally speaking, Sugino make pretty good chainsets, or did they recommend it because nothing else is compatible? I'm guessing the former..
